Output 9296dd9176a6efcee632ae61c7d2198ea02860c4c422b802a621331b16332d60:6

value
22093961
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b26ada27d81c0a18ffc9fdbadd6ecc2beb604e253e06bc819f657292f8ada53
address
tb1phvn2mgnas8q2rrlunld6m4hvc2ltvp8z20sxhjqe7etjjtu2mffsh3m65f
transaction
9296dd9176a6efcee632ae61c7d2198ea02860c4c422b802a621331b16332d60
confirmations
12493
spent
true